## Authentication

Heads up: the nightly reindex job (`reindex_nightly.py`) talks to the Lanternfish search cluster, and that cluster won't accept anonymous writes anymore — we locked it down last sprint. The job now authenticates as the `reindex-runner` service identity against Corvid Gateway, and the token is injected via the `LF_INDEX_TOKEN` env var in the scheduler config. Nothing clever going on, just a bearer header on every batch request. For review purposes, the staging credential currently in use is listed below.

service key, kadug-kadup: kto15_rN23XLAYImmZgrJ

Subject: Hedging call for FY26

Hi everyone,

As flagged at the last board session, we've decided to hedge roughly 70% of our forecast thaler exposure for the Vorland expansion, using twelve-month forwards. Treasury ran three scenarios, and the unhedged downside was simply too ugly given our thin margins on the Pellan contract. Cost of the programme is modest — about 0.8% of notional — and Renna's team will manage rollovers quarterly. Happy to walk anyone through the models. The rationale ties directly to the plan summarised below.

board note of tawip-hahip: Only 7 of the 80 pilot accounts renewed Ralath, so a churn review is set for April 1.

## Environments — Grainlink Telemetry Gateway

Quick orientation for on-call: we run three environments — dev, staging, and prod — and they are not symmetric, which bites people regularly. Dev talks to simulated tractors only; staging gets a trickle of real telemetry from the test farm; prod handles the full fleet. Ingest buffer sizes and MQTT retry behavior differ per environment on purpose, so don't copy settings across. When paged, check prod first. The prod gateway currently runs with the following values.

service settings:
[silwyn]
host = silwyn.crelvogrid.internal
user = silwyn_svc
database = silwyn_prod